Wardogservers.com presents itself as an independent community server listing for the WAR DOGS game. The site looks functional, has custom branding, and runs on a solid Cloudflare setup. So is it safe to use? That depends on what you need from it.
The biggest red flag is the domain age: it was registered on September 2, 2026, just over a week ago. For a site that collects server listings and encourages users to submit their own, the absence of a privacy policy or terms of service is unusual. Without those pages, it's unclear what rights you're granting the site or how your data is handled. For context, most gaming directories of this size that have been around for a while have clear legal pages.
On the technical side, the encryption is mostly fine, but the site still accepts outdated TLS 1.0 and 1.1 connections, which are known to be vulnerable. And there are no social media links or other trail to the people running the show.
If you're asking 'is wardogservers.com a scam,' the evidence doesn't support that label β nothing malicious was detected. But the combination of a brand-new domain, missing policies, and minimal operator transparency means you should treat it with measured caution until it proves itself over time.
